When Doris Mabel Raymond was born on 28 September 1904, in England, United Kingdom, her father, Oliver Tadeus Raymond, was 26 and her mother, Mabel Edith Thompson, was 21. She married Harvey Ricks on 15 August 1931. They were the parents of at least 1 son. She lived in Islington, London, England, United Kingdom in 1911 and Alberta, Canada in 1916. She died on 12 June 1983, in Long Beach, Los Angeles, California, United States, at the age of 78, and was buried in Los Angeles, Los Angeles, California, United States.

English and French: from the Norman personal name Raimund or Raimond, from ancient Germanic Raginmund, composed of the elements ragin ‘advice, counsel’ + mund ‘protection’. Compare Ramo and Raymo .
Americanized form of Italian Raimondo and German Raimund, cognates of 1 above. Compare Raimond .
